House Prices .io

Instant prices paid data for England and Wales

Latest house prices for Ballards Road, London

Details of 43 sales available for this area

Date Price Address
19/02/2024 Details... £330,000 3 Ballards Road, London, NW2 7UE Details...
30/09/2022 Details... £588,000 10 Ballards Road, London, NW2 7UG Details...
18/02/2022 Details... £450,000 22 Ballards Road, London, NW2 7UG Details...
21/05/2021 Details... £425,000 28a Ballards Road, London, NW2 7UG Details...
30/10/2020 Details... £570,000 73 Ballards Road, London, NW2 7UE Details...
26/10/2018 Details... £470,000 50 Ballards Road, London, NW2 7UG Details...
10/01/2014 Details... £450,000 30 Ballards Road, London, NW2 7UG Details...
28/10/2013 Details... £345,000 17 Ballards Road, London, NW2 7UE Details...
02/12/2011 Details... £290,000 39 Ballards Road, London, NW2 7UE Details...
13/06/2011 Details... £315,000 61 Ballards Road, London, NW2 7UE Details...
01/03/2010 Details... £330,000 34 Ballards Road, London, NW2 7UG Details...
05/08/2009 Details... £305,000 42 Ballards Road, London, NW2 7UG Details...
21/12/2007 Details... £355,000 3 Ballards Road, London, NW2 7UE Details...
28/11/2006 Details... £330,000 11 Ballards Road, London, NW2 7UE Details...
07/06/2006 Details... £250,000 67 Ballards Road, London, NW2 7UE Details...
19/05/2006 Details... £260,000 34 Ballards Road, London, NW2 7UG Details...
04/04/2006 Details... £250,000 5 Ballards Road, London, NW2 7UE Details...
22/03/2006 Details... £325,000 35 Ballards Road, London, NW2 7UE Details...
08/11/2005 Details... £250,000 11 Ballards Road, London, NW2 7UE Details...
16/04/2004 Details... £266,000 72 Ballards Road, London, NW2 7UG Details...
1 2 3 Next